http://bioconductor.org/packages/release/bioc/html/CorMut.html
THIS RESOURCE IS NO LONGER IN SERVICE. Documented on August 16,2023. Software package for computing correlated mutations based on selection pressure. Three methods are provided for detecting correlated mutations, including conditional selection pressure, mutual information and Jaccard index. The computation consists of two steps: First, the positive selection sites are detected; second, the mutation correlations are computed among the positive selection sites. Note that the first step is optional. Meanwhile, CorMut facilitates the comparison of the correlated mutations between two conditions by the means of correlated mutation network.

http://dna.leeds.ac.uk/illuminator/
A sequence alignment program for the output from Illumina GA-II clonal sequencers. It uses an algorithm that indexes the reference sequence as a series of 8-mers and then matches the genomic reads to the 8-mer index, in a mutation-tolerant way permitting identification of single-nucleotide substitutions and indels.
